    So he shows that Grambling and ULM have the same problem we do by General Fund Transfers. So being in the WAC is irrelevant to his argument. We seem to always be the target of these types of articles. Fact is athletics are important to universities. Exhibit A is SLU, who had dropped football several years ago, only to realize that it was a major mistake. They have restarted their program. Also, many of the FCS schools are moving up around the country. So the economics would seem to indicate that there is value in moving "up". The problem is not with TECH, but with archaic funding laws that were meant to make sure that schools like TECH or even ULL would not leave other sister schools behind, and to keep us in place beneath LSU.
